Bright Kaluba is my name and am a young entrepreneur dealing mainly in grocery business. I did my primary education and secondary education but couldn't proceed to do any college education because of financial challenges.Life has been very tough in my family, but I worked hard to start my own grocery store.
After failing to go to college I started working in Shoprite I worked for 3 years and its from there I said I could work on my own and sell groceries because i saw how much demand groceries have. Almost everyday people use groceries at home. I started with small capital of K500 and now my capital is about K2,000.I just need a loan to increase goods in my shop.
I currently sell groceries such as sugar, tooth paste, washing powder, cooking oil and others. And I need to increase the quantity of these goods in my shop so that I can make more profit to support myself and my family. I will be happy if a loan can be given to me. when I sell and make profits I will ay back the loan quickly and save some money.
From the sales I make everyday i will be able to pay back loan. Groceries are important items in a house so sales are there everyday even during this period of Corona virus.
